The “Update Findings” page appears.

Note: The system does not allow the following:

1. Deletion of a row in the multiline if it has been saved in the Summary of Observations or Final NC Report tab pages.

2. Deletion of all the rows in the multiline which has Ques IDs with the “Mandatory?” field marked as “Yes”.

3. Deletion of checklist questions which are marked as “Mandatory”.

The system displays the following field:

Line #

A system generated number indicating the line number of the entry in the multiline.

Note that this number is used as a cross reference for the  entries in the “Summary of Observations” and the “Final Entry Report” tab pages.

Ques ID

A user defined identification number for the questionnaire

Requirement

The question text.

Audit Observation

Any observation other than negative recording during the audit.

Audit Findings

Any negative audit observation to be recorded during Audit which can lead to a Non conformance.

Auditor #

The employee number of the auditor who leads the audit team.

Ensure the employee code entered in this field:

  • Is a valid employee number which has Employment Status as “Current” in the “Employee Information” business component

  • Is mapped to a user name as on the current date.

Help facility available

Auditee #

The employee code of the primary auditee

Ensure that the number entered in this field:

  • Is a valid employee number which has Employment Status as “Current” in the “Employee Information” business component

  • Is mapped to a User Name as on the current date.

Help facility available

Note: The system displays the Auditor # and Auditee # columns in the multiline only if the Audit Observation and Audit Findings columns are specified.

Document / Record Reviewed

Reference of any document or record in a document supporting the observations and findings of the audit.

Remarks

Any remarks regarding the questions.

Audit Notes

Any information pertinent to the audit.

The system generates the following.

Mandatory?

Indicates whether the given question is mandatory to be responded while auditing which could be “Yes” or “No”.

Audit Instruction

Step-by-step instruction on how the audit must be conducted.

Check Point

The broad classification based on which question is asked like for example, Safety, Security and so on.

Checklist #

A unique code identifying the checklist used for auditing

Question Type

The type of question in the checklist.

Question Category

The category to which the question belongs

Reference Details

Any details regarding the reference document number.

Seq #

The sequence number in which the questions need to appear in the checklist.

The system updates the Audit Status in the Audit Report Details group box as “Findings Recorded”.

Prerequisite

1. An Audit Report must have been created

2. The Audit Report # must have Checklist Based? set as “Yes”.

3. The Audit Status in the “Audit Report Details” group box must be other than "Findings Confirmed", "Pending Action", "Pending Closure", or "Closed
